SUMMARY The Capital Markets Intern will support the Capital Markets team and the broader Corporate Finance group in advancing Welltower’s investment opportunities and growth strategy. This highly visible role provides hands-on exposure to strategic initiatives and collaboration with senior management.

Responsibilities

  • Assist in preparing presentations and materials for institutional investors, Wall Street analysts, bank groups, and rating agencies.
  • Support multi-year strategic planning presentations for the Company’s Board of Directors.
  • Help organize investor meetings, property tours, conferences, and respond to investor inquiries.
  • Monitor trends in equity, fixed income, foreign exchange, and derivatives markets to support balance sheet and capital strategy analysis.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ure effective communication of the company’s operational performance and strategic initiatives.
